Ever since it was announced in April 2015, extending
Right to Buy to housing association tenants has generated lots of interest.
There were lots of angles to explore, lots of different views to debate and
discuss and lots of speculation about the impact. When the Prime Minister
accepted the housing association offer to voluntarily sell homes to tenants
with a discount paid for by the Government, this raised a whole new set of
questions. When would housing associations start selling homes? Who would be
